Baylor earns #2 seed, will host Abilene Christian in first round of NCAA Women's Soccer Tournament

Baylor, the Big 12 regular season champions and tournament runners up, will host Abilene Christian at Betty Lou Mays Soccer Field this weekend as a #2 seed in the 2018 NCAA Women's Soccer Tournament.

"Getting the two seed, we get to be at Betty Lou again which is so much fun. We've been away for a week in Kansas City, so being able to bring it back home is gonna be great," Julie James, a senior midfielder for the Bears, said. "Getting in the tournament is just really exciting, it's just a fun time and new season. We can't get complacent with just getting in though. We're excited to make another run and just take one game at a time and do our best with it."

The Bears played the Wildcats at the beginning of the year winning 2-0. But, that doesn't meant they're taking this first round match-up lightly. 

"It was a tough 2-0 victory early in the season. We've matured, they've matured, so we're gonna go back and catch up on the last 19 games that they've played and see how they've matured as a team and try to lock in and find a good game plan to compete and hopefully win that game," Baylor Soccer Head Coach Paul Jobson said. 

Game time for ACU versus Baylor is set for 7:30 p.m. Saturday.
